The Case for Leasing a Mercedes-Benz

If you decide to lease your next Mercedes-Benz, you are saving money, obviously. Leasing is also better than taking out an auto loan, because when you compare the monthly payment for your lease, with the monthly payment for your auto loan, you will notice that the lease payment is more affordable. This works out for you, because you will be buying the same car but for less money.

On the other side, the money you are saving from the lease, may be spent on other things like penalties for excess mileage, wear and tear. One of the biggest reasons for leasing a Mercedes-Benz is that you can drive around in a brand-new luxury car without having to pay the optimum price for it.

Leasing a Mercedes-Benz from Mercedes-Benz Brampton means you get a standard 3-year contract, which lets you exchange your old Mercedes-Benz for a brand-new top-of-the-line model every 3 years!

The Case for Buying a Mercedes-Benz

You can outright buy a new Mercedes-Benz, and claim full ownership of the car. There are no complications with contracts, and you can rest easy knowing that you have got this Mercedes-Benz for years to come. Some people like that stability of having complete ownership of a car, and if you have the finances, you should just go ahead and buy it.

You also don’t have to worry about driving your car out of state or on long trips, because there is no agreed-upon annual mileage requirements. The biggest benefit of buying a Mercedes-Benz upfront is knowing that you don’t have to keep making monthly payments, which happens when you lease a car. When you own a Mercedes-Benz, you have financial freedom, and can start saving up the additional money for when you decide to upgrade to a newer top-of-the-line model.
